一、项目背景与目标
1.项目背景
在这一部分,你需要详细描述App的背景和背景故事。解释为什么需要这个App,它将如何解决现有的市场痛点,以及它的潜在价值。这个部分的目的是让团队成员和投资者清楚地了解App的创意来源和意义。
示例:“在当今数字化时代,越来越多的人在日常生活中依赖移动设备。目前市场上缺乏一款能够同时满足多方面需求的健康管理App。我们的目标是开发一款能够整合健康管理、运动追踪、饮食建议等功能的App,以帮助用户更好地管理自己的健康。”

2.项目目标
在这一部分,你需要明确App的核心目标。包括短期和长期目标,如用户数目、市场份额、收入增长等。这些目标应具体、可测量、可实现、相关性强和有时限(SMART原则)。
示例:“我们的短期目标是在第一年内吸引10万活跃用户,并在第二年内实现每月用户增长率达到20%。长期目标是在五年内成为市场领先者,拥有100万活跃用户。”
二、市场调研与分析
1.市场概况
在这一部分,你需要提供关于目标市场的详细分析。包括市场规模、增长趋势、市场细分等。这些数据将帮助你了解市场的整体情况,以及你的App将在其中占据的位置。
示例:“根据市场调研数据显示,全球健康管理App市场预计将在未来五年内以年复合增长率15%增长,市场规模将达到200亿美元。目前主要竞争对手包括Fitbit、MyFitnessPal等。”
2.竞争分析
在这一部分,你需要分析主要竞争对手的优劣势。通过对竞争对手的功能、用户评价、市场表现等进行详细分析,找出你的App可以从中吸取的经验教训,以及你将如何在市场中脱颖而出。
示例:“Fitbit的优势在于其强大的硬件生态系统和高用户忠诚度。其缺乏个性化的饮食建议功能。我们的App将结合硬件和软件,提供个性化的健康管理方案,从而弥补Fitbit的不足。”
三、需求分析与功能设计
1.用户需求
在这一部分,你需要详细列出你的目标用户群体,并通过问卷调查、访谈等方式获取用户的需求。这将为你设计功能提供直接的指导。
示例:“通过对500名潜在用户的调研,我们发现他们希望App能够提供个性化的健康管理方案,包括每日运动提醒、饮食建议、健康数据同步等。”
2.功能设计
在这一部分,你需要详细列出App的主要功能和子功能。每个功能应包括其功能描述、用户使用场景、技术实现方案等。
示例:“主要功能包括:个性化健康管理、运动追踪、饮食建议、健康数据同步。个性化健康管理功能将根据用户的健康数据和偏好提供个性化的健康建议。运动追踪功能将通过与智能手表等设备同步,记录用户的运动数据。饮食建议功能将根据用户的健康数据和偏好,提供每日饮食建议。
”
四、技术方案与架构设计
1.技术栈选择
在这一部分,你需要明确选择的前端和后端技术栈。详细说明为什么选择这些技术,以及它们如何满足项目需求。
示例:“我们选择使用ReactNative进行前端开发,因为它能够实现跨平台开发,提高开发效率。后端我们将使用Node.js搭建服务器,结合MongoDB进行数据存储,以确保高效的数据处理和扩展性。”
2.架构设计
在这一部分,你需要提供系统的架构图和详细的架构设计说明。包括系统的总体架构、各个模块之间的关系、数据流等。
示例:“系统的总体架构包括前端、后端和数据库三个部分。前端通过API与后端进行通信,后端处理业务逻辑并与数据库进行数据交互。数据库将存储用户健康数据和其他相关信息。”
五、项目管理与进度计划
1.项目管理
在这一部分,你需要详细描述项目管理的方法和工具。包括团队结构、职责分工、项目管理工具等。
示例:“我们将采用敏捷开发方法,使用JIRA进行任务管理。项目团队包括产品经理、前端开发工程师、后端开发工程师、测试工程师等。产品经理负责需求分析和产品管理,前端和后端开发工程师负责代码开发,测试工程师负责测试和质量保证。”

2.进度计划
在这一部分,你需要提供详细的项目进度计划,包括各个阶段的任务和时间节点。
示例:“项目将分为三个阶段:需求分析与设计、开发与测试、上线与维护。需求分析与设计阶段将在项目启动后的一个月内完成,开发与测试阶段将持续六个月,最后上线与维护阶段将在项目启动后的七个月内完成。”
六、预算计划与资源配置
1.预算计划
在这一部分,你需要详细列出项目预算,包###在这一部分,你需要详细列出项目预算,包括开发成本、市场推广费用、运营成本等。这将帮助你确保项目在预算范围内顺利进行。
示例:“项目总预算为500万元,其中包括开发成本200万元、市场推广费用150万元、运营成本150万元。开发成本主要包括人员工资、服务器租赁费用等。市场推广费用将用于广告投放、公关活动等。运营成本包括服务器维护费用、人员工资等。”
2.资源配置
在这一部分,你需要详细描述项目所需的资源配置,包括人力资源、财务资源、技术资源等。
示例:“项目团队将包括10名成员,包括1名产品经理、3名前端开发工程师、3名后端开发工程师、2名测试工程师、1名UI/UX设计师。团队将配备一台服务器用于开发和测试,另外将租用云服务器用于正式上线。财务方面,将配置一笔预算用于开发、推广和运营。

”
七、风险管理与应对策略
1.风险识别
在这一部分,你需要识别项目可能遇到的风险。包括技术风险、市场风险、运营风险等。详细描述每个风险的可能影响。
示例:“项目可能面临的风险包括技术风险、市场风险、运营风险。技术风险包括开发过程中遇到的技术难题,可能导致开发进度延迟。市场风险包括市场竞争激烈,用户接受度不高等。运营风险包括服务器维护问题,可能导致服务中断。”
2.风险应对策略
在这一部分,你需要提供针对每个风险的应对策略。详细描述如何预防和应对这些风险。
示例:“针对技术风险,我们将采用敏捷开发方法,定期进行代码审查,确保代码质量。针对市场风险,我们将通过市场调研和用户反馈,不断优化产品,提高用户满意度。针对运营风险,我们将选择可靠的云服务商,定期进行系统维护,确保服务的稳定性。”

八、测试计划与发布准备
1.测试计划
在这一部分,你需要详细描述测试计划,包括测试类型、测试对象、测试时间表等。确保产品在发布前能够经过充分的测试。
示例:“测试计划包括单元测试、集成测试、系统测试和用户验收测试。单元测试将在开发过程中进行,集成测试和系统测试将在开发完成后进行,用户验收测试将在发布前进行。测试时间表如下:单元测试在开发的前三个月进行,集成测试和系统测试在第四和第五个月进行,用户验收测试在发布前的一个月进行。
”
2.发布准备
在这一部分,你需要详细描述发布准备工作,包括版本发布、市场推广、用户培训等。确保产品发布后能够顺利上线并获得用户认可。
示例:“发布准备工作包括版本发布、市场推广和用户培训。版本发布将在测试完成后进行,市场推广将在发布前一个月启动,包括广告投放、公关活动等。用户培训将在发布后进行,通过在线视频、用户手册等方式帮助用户快速上手。”
九、运营维护与持续改进
1.运营维护
在这一部分,你需要详细描述运营维护工作,包括系统维护、用户支持、数据分析等。确保产品在上线后能够保持稳定运行并满足用户需求。
示例:“运营维护工作包括系统维护、用户支持和数据分析。系统维护将定期进行,包括服务器维护、系统升级等。用户支持将通过客服热线、在线客服等方式提供,及时解决用户问题。数据分析将定期进行,通过分析用户行为数据,优化产品功能和服务。”
2.持续改进
在这一部分,你需要详细描述持续改进工作,包括用户反馈收集、功能优化、产品升级等。确保产品能够不断优化,满足用户不断变化的需求。
示例:“持续改进工作包括用户反馈收集、功能优化和产品升级。用户反馈将通过在线问卷、客服热线等方式收集,定期分析并优化产品功能。产品升级将根据用户反馈和市场趋势,定期进行,确保产品始终处于行业前沿。”
通过以上详细的策划书模版,你将能够为你的App开发项目制定出一个全面、详细且高效的开发计划。这不仅将为你的项目提供明确的方向,还将为你提供有力的支持,确保你的App开发项目能够顺利进行并最终取得成功。希望这份策划书模版能够为你的App开发项目提供有价值的参考和帮助。



